Brief Description:  Mask cabin top and doors, prime

Masked off the interior of the cabin top for Zolatone. Did a couple of small patches with body filler, rest was done with micro earlier. Masked off the doors, sanded the rough spots down, the Zolatone should cover the minor imperfections.

Shot the door and cabin top interiors with gray epoxy primer. They came out smooth, but full of pinholes and other minor things. The first coat of Zolatone will cover them, one of the benefits of this stuff.

Although the primer said it was Ok to top coat it after 30 minutes, that would be with a compatible material. I am not too surethat the Zolatone is compatible with this primer, so I decided to wait until tomorrow to shoot the Zolatone. Put some Zolatone on a small test piece with some primer that dried for about 30 minutes. Sure would have hated to have to sand it off the complete cabin and door interiors. This stuff is tough when it dries. My test board resisted far more rubbing and scraping than it will get in real life. And that was after about 20 hours, the spec sheet says full strength is about a week.After testing decided not to use the catylast that is suppose to increase resistance to water, etc.
